Modelling and circuit realisation of a new no‐equilibrium chaotic system with hidden attractor and coexisting attractors

Qiang Lai, Zhiqiang Wan, Paul Didier Kamdem Kuate

Open publisher page 81 citations

Abstract

This Letter reports a new no‐equilibrium chaotic system with hidden attractors and coexisting attractors. Bifurcation diagram shows that the proposed system generates chaos through period‐doubling bifurcation with the variation of system parameters, and the hidden chaotic and periodic attractors are visually given by phase portraits. The coexisting chaotic and periodic attractors from different initial conditions are observed in the system. The analogue circuit realisation and microcontroller‐based experimental implementation of the system are given to verify its physical existence.
